Reach For The Moon Profile

Reach For The Moon is a 4 year old bay gelding. Reach For The Moon is trained by C Gafa, at Moe and owned by Mrs M Gafa & Ms B L J Gafa.

Reach For The Moon’s last race event was at 14/05/2024 and their next race is on 23/05/2024 at Pakenham.
